Both platforms require PDF/X-1a format with CMYK images, but their margin and bleed specifications differ. KDP requires 0.125" bleed on all four sides and a minimum gutter of 0.375" for books under 150 pages, scaling up to 0.875" for 600-page manuscripts. IngramSpark has slightly different bleed requirements depending on paper stock (white vs cream) and enforces stricter ink density limits (300% maximum total ink coverage). DesignDile builds InDesign export presets for both platforms within a single source file, so you receive compliant PDFs for both without paying a separate formatting fee.

No — and this is one of the most common and costly mistakes in self-publishing. A print PDF is a fixed-layout file with exact page dimensions, margins, bleed, and embedded fonts. A Kindle or Apple Books ebook must be a reflowable document that adapts to every screen size from a phone to a tablet. They are fundamentally different file types. DesignDile produces both from the same InDesign project: a print-ready PDF/X-1a for KDP and IngramSpark paperback/hardcover, and a reflowable EPUB3 for Kindle and Apple Books. Both outputs are included in the Premium and Elite tiers.

DesignDile formats for all standard KDP and IngramSpark trim sizes including 6x9 inches for non-fiction, 5.5x8.5 inches for fiction, 8.5x11 inches for workbooks, and children's book sizes such as 8.5x8.5 and 8x10 inches.
